Derived from Old English 'garleac', combining 'gar' (spear) and 'leac' (leek), referring to the spear-shaped cloves of the plant. Historically prized for culinary and medicinal uses, garlic symbolizes protection and vitality across various cultures.

Fun Fact About Garlic

Garlic has been used for over 5,000 years both as food and medicine, believed to protect warriors and ward off evil spirits.
